PETER Andre has landed a part in a Channel 5 murder mystery - following backlash over a movie role.
The singer, 52, will be flexing different performing muscles with a new role.

He plays a pathologist, crime-solving doctor George, in The Sunshine Murders.
Set in Cyprus, the new series will be debuting on Channel 5 in September.
It stars Star Trek actress Marina Sirtis and ex-EastEnders star Nina Wadia.
Meanwhile, Peter recently addressed backlash from fans for his role in comedy film Jafaican.
He plays conman Gazza, who must master a Caribbean accent and culture to impersonate a notorious Jamaican gangster for a £3million payout.
Peter previously told The Sun: "When I read the script, I spent the whole time laughing.
'It was warm, with a deep, heartfelt message about what someone would do to care for the person that they love.
"It was also a beautiful tribute to Jamaica.
'But for me, working on Jafaican has been a dream come true.
'I know some people were a bit sceptical at first because we didn't know whether I could deliver what we had planned, but the reviews we've had have been phenomenal.
Emotional Peter Andre reveals strict rule for Princess and Junior
'I studied acting as a kid before going into music from 16, but I always knew I was going to come back to it.
"I always said to my dad, 'when I get to my 40s, I'm moving back into film, that's what I want to do'.'
However, fans were left cringing at Peter's attempt of doing a Jamaican accent.
One penned: "What is happening here lad?"
While another added: "LMFAO, this is the most original thing I've seen in a while."
A third chimed in: "This looks hilarious can't wait to see this."
Jafaican also stars Hollyoaks actor Jamie Lomas - known as bad boy Warren Fox.

After battling kidney cancer in 2000, James launched the charity Kidney Cancer UK to increase knowledge and awareness, funding research into the causes, prevention and treatment of the disease. He had fathered two kids with Melinda Maxted, James and Peter, before she herself was diagnosed with stage four lung cancer. Melinda died in May 2018, just three months after James made the announcement of her diagnosis. In 2020, James revealed the disease had returned and spread to his spine, brain and lungs, and has shared his ongoing cancer battle candidly with listeners and viewers over the past few years. A year later, on his 70th birthday, James announced his engagement to Nadine Lamont-Brown, before marrying her in October of that year. The powerhouse presenter had been a staple of the airwaves for over 50 years and was awarded an MBE in the 2023 King's New Year Honours List for his outstanding contribution to broadcasting. At the time, he told The Sun: "I'm exceptionally thrilled as somebody who's been able to enjoy their job for their entire life and receiving an award like this is just the best." James celebrated the milestone with hundreds of pals at an £80,000 bash in Mayfair - paid for by millionaire Charlie Mullins and organised by his pals Chuck Thomas and Andre Walker. He had also received the first-ever TRIC Recognition Award for his outstanding work across 50 years. James began his career with Metro Radio in 1974 where he pioneered the concept of the late night radio phone-in. Five decades later, James was still heard hosting the phone-in, every Saturday night, on TalkTV and TalkRadio. His late-night series, the James Whale Show, which was broadcast live simultaneously on Radio Aire in Leeds and ITV in the 1980s, made the genre famous. In 1988, after gaining a loyal legion of listeners who loved his unique acerbic and incisive style, The James Whale Radio Show was simulcast live on television every Friday night on ITV, pulling in over one million viewers. 'GIANT OF RADIO AND TELEVISION' James went on to host Whale On, Dial Midnight and Central Weekend Live for ITV, Talk About for BBC One, and more recently appeared on Channel 5's Celebrity Big Brother. 2008 saw his autobiography, A Lifetime Of Night-Time, published as well as him falling into hot water after he urged listeners on TalkSport to vote for Boris Johnson in that year's London mayoral election. The acerbic and outspoken host was reportedly suspended again in 2018 after appearing to laugh at a guest who was speaking about her rape on air. The much-loved presenter had also hosted a range of shows on BBC local radios and LBC, before appearing on Celebrity Big Brother in 2016 for its eighteenth series. He was the sixth person to be evicted on the reality show, coming in ninth place overall. Late in 2016, James began covering shows on TalkRadio, before becoming a host himself of a Monday to Thursday evening show. Most recently, he held the 10pm to 1am slot on a Friday night on TalkRadio, a time described as his "spiritual home". In early 2024, James was awarded the first ever TRIC Recognition Award for his 50 years in broadcasting, with his 'true grit and determination to entertain and inform the nation every week', not least in the face of his illness. At the time of the award, Richard Wallace, Head of TalkTV, said: 'There are legends - and then there's James Whale. "This award is a fitting acknowledgment of a maverick talent who has entertained TV and radio audiences with inimitable style for more than 50 years.' Dennie Morris, Director of Audio, News Broadcasting, added: 'James is not only a giant of radio and television, but one of the loveliest men I've ever met. "His contribution to the industry and to charity over the years has been remarkable. "I can think of no one more deserving of this honour.'
